Key System Components That Affect Performance

When it comes to optimizing your PC’s performance, understanding the key components that impact its functionality is crucial. Knowing how these elements interact can help you diagnose slowdowns and improve overall efficiency. So, let’s dive into what these components are!

1. CPU (Central Processing Unit)

The CPU is often referred to as the brain of the computer. It handles instructions from both hardware and software. Its performance can directly affect your system’s capability to multitask and run applications smoothly. If your CPU is outdated, consider upgrading to a more powerful one.

2. RAM (Random Access Memory)

RAM is crucial for storing temporary data and ensuring quick access for tasks. If your system runs low on RAM, it might lead to noticeable lag, especially during heavy usage like gaming or video editing. Upgrading RAM can significantly enhance responsiveness and speed.

3. Storage Types

HDDs (Hard Disk Drives) are slower compared to SSDs (Solid State Drives). Switching from an HDD to an SSD can drastically reduce loading times and increase the overall performance of your system, making it feel much faster and more agile. In today’s world, SSDs have become the preferred storage option for faster data access.
